Transaction 26c26286750817f2d8f965d1308aa4dd8423ef2a9f108bfdb84d7d26512fb3c1
1 Input
1 Output
-
26c26286750817f2d8f965d1308aa4dd8423ef2a9f108bfdb84d7d26512fb3c1:0
- value
- 884668
- script pubkey
- OP_0 OP_PUSHBYTES_20 ffd16381bcccf8b3e4cb74b1283f0a1e30356a3f
- address
- bc1qllgk8qduenut8extwjcjs0c2rccr263ln9cmyc